Why Tremendous blocks crypto purchases on the card
Tremendous classifies cryptocurrency exchanges and wallet funding as prohibited merchant categories. The block is not a technical glitch or a temporary hold. It is a deliberate policy applied to every Tremendous Visa Reward Card globally.
This means you cannot:
- Fund a Binance, Bybit, or Coinbase account with a Tremendous Visa card
- Buy Bitcoin on Cash App using the card
- Top up a Trust Wallet, Blockchain.com, or MetaMask wallet with the card
- Purchase USDT, ETH, or any other token on any exchange using the card directly
- Use P2P platforms like Paxful or Noones to buy crypto with the card
The block applies to both virtual and physical Tremendous Visa cards. Attempting the purchase anyway does not just decline the transaction. It can sometimes trigger a temporary review on the card, locking the balance for 24 to 48 hours while Tremendous clears the flag.

The $50 minimum for crypto payouts
There is one condition to know before you start: the Naira equivalent of your Tremendous Visa card trade must be at least $50 (at the current exchange rate) for FlipEx to process a crypto payout. This minimum is not a FlipEx policy choice. It comes from the crypto provider's minimum send limit on the blockchain network used for the transfer.
What this means in practice:
- A $50 or higher Tremendous card qualifies for crypto payout in a single trade.
- A $25 Tremendous card does not meet the $50 minimum on its own. You would need to combine it with another gift card trade in the same session to reach the threshold, or take the Naira payout instead and buy crypto separately from your FlipEx wallet.
- A $5 or $10 card from a small survey payout is below the threshold. Take the Naira payout. You can still convert Naira to crypto inside FlipEx once your wallet balance reaches the minimum.

Can I get paid to Cash App or PayPal from a Tremendous Visa card?
Tremendous explicitly blocks direct transfers to Cash App, PayPal, Venmo, and Zelle. Those are all listed as prohibited destinations in the Tremendous help centre.
FlipEx sidesteps this entirely. Because the card is sold to FlipEx as a prepaid Visa (not transferred to Cash App), the Tremendous restriction does not apply. FlipEx can then pay out to your Tremendous Visa card to Cash App BTC address, your PayPal crypto balance, or any other wallet. The key is that the crypto payout goes to your wallet, and Tremendous never sees a prohibited-category transaction on the card.
To receive Bitcoin on Cash App specifically: open Cash App, tap the Bitcoin tab, tap Receive, and copy your BTC address. Provide that address to FlipEx when selecting your payout method during the trade.
